Chimney crown or flashing repair costs $200 to $500. Crown replacement costs $1,000 … how to say both in japaneseWebLEANING CHIMNEY. Often you see chimneys pulling away from houses. In most cases, this is caused by differential settlement between the house foundation and the chimney foundation. The chimney often is placed on a separate foundation. Many times, this foundation is only 2’-3’ deep, while adjacent to a full house basement. north fork vineyards mapWebThe brick pulls away from the side of the house.
